The Overall Health Score in 03814, Center Ossipee, New Hampshire is 34 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
87.54 percent of the population in 03814 drive to work alone. 1.13 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 45.14 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 11.71 percent of the residents in 03814 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.27 members with about 2.22 cars available per household.
An estimate of 88.34 percent of the residents in 03814 has some form of health insurance. 39.04 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 61.22 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 03814 would have to travel an average of 20.29 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Memorial Hospital, The . In a 20-mile radius, there are 48 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 03814, Center Ossipee, New Hampshire.

As of , an estimate of 2,349 residents live in 03814 with a median age of 45.4 years. 15.62 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 16.13 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 30.88 percent of the residents in 03814 is currently married, and 21.70 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 03814 is $5,648.17.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 03814 is approximately $1,027. The median household spends about 18.18 percent of their income on housing.
